Exactly five years ago, on May 16, 2021, WWE delivered one of the most bizarre segments in its recent history at WrestleMania Backlash, during the rivalry between Damian Priest and The Miz.

At the event, Priest faced Miz in a Lumberjack Match, but the usual wrestlers surrounding the ring were replaced by zombies as a promotional tie-in for Army of the Dead, the movie starring Batista.

During the match, The Miz and John Morrison tried to escape several times, but were stopped by the horde. Morrison ended up being “devoured” first, distracting Miz and opening the door for Priest to hit Hit the Lights and win the match.

After the match was over, Miz was also surrounded by the zombies in the middle of the ring, closing out one of the most remembered — and criticized — moments of the ThunderDome era.

The big fun fact is that some of the zombies were WWE Performance Center talents. Among them was Bronson Rechsteiner, who would debut in NXT months later under the name Bron Breakker.

In addition to Breakker, names such as Joe Gacy, Xyon Quinn, Ikemen Jiro, Jake Atlas, Ari Sterling and even Scotty 2 Hotty also took part in the scene, all unrecognizable under the makeup.
